Transaction 6a3e29a78fe655c43b4a1ae4aeb374b4e63eae0e6a58c28cbe36bef885e977ef
1 Input
2 Outputs
- 6a3e29a78fe655c43b4a1ae4aeb374b4e63eae0e6a58c28cbe36bef885e977ef:0
- 6a3e29a78fe655c43b4a1ae4aeb374b4e63eae0e6a58c28cbe36bef885e977ef:1
value 147147
address 15ybNNx1YFGr4AX4brzufqHcbFHEtcn3pY
value 383941134
address 3MfN5to5K5be2RupWE8rjJHQ6V9L8ypWeh